CMS Awards Prescription Drug Management Contract

CMS has announced that it has awarded a contract to NDCHealth, based in Atlanta, GA,

“to provide the electronic services as part of a system forcalculating Medciare Part D beneficiaries’ “True Out-Of-Pocket costs.”  NDCHealth isrequired to provide routing of claims for benefits paid by entitiesother than Medicare back to the prescription drug plans to ensure thatwhat seniors pay at pharmacy counters takes into account the properlevel of their Medicare coverage.  The $416,700, one-year contract withthree one-year extensions requires NDCHealth to develop an electronicsystem similar to systems that pharmacists already use to billinsurance plans for prescription drug claims.  The contract alsoincludes up to $3.9 million for processing transactions during a singleyear. “
